After the breakup of the Soviet Union, documentation was made available that we'd never seen before. Kennedy assumed that Russian missile commanders had to get nuclear launch orders from the Kremlin, so he had wide-band radio jamming initiated for Cuba. The Russian documentation revealed that Russian missile commanders may fire anything they have available if they are cut off from higher levels. This is contrary to all other Russian military command structures. The missiles in Cuba were under the command of junior officers, who had the missiles "spun up and targeted". One senior officer placed them in a "wait and see" hold. Had Kennedy made one more aggressive move, they would have launched.
Khrushchev told Kennedy that if the US would lift the jamming he would order an stand down.

They were Jupiter medium range missiles night Titan. Titans were intercontinental missiles and liquid fueled as well. (Titans didn’t become solid fueled until the Titan III generation.) The Jupiter missiles were liquid fueled so basically obsolete. So, we traded off a soon to be obsolete system and I guess promised the Soviets we wouldn’t replace it. Not sure we won that deal!
